Re: Trouble with diaresis and ssharp key



On Wed, Dec 16, 1998 at 10:57:16PM +0100, homega@vlc.servicom.es wrote:
> Stefan Gundel dixit:
> >
> > Hello, everybody,
> > 
> > I am presently experiencing the following problem:
> > 
> > On my hamm installation I get only beeps when pressing the diaresis keys
> > on my german keyboard (i.e. adiaresis, odiaresis, udiaresis). Pressing the
> > ssharp key gives me an output similar to <ESC-.> . The consoles and X
> > terminals behave similarly. Issuing commands like "loadkeys ..." or
> > defining a new xmodmap map didn't improve things. On the other hand I can
> > display documents containing these characters and can also use the keys
> > within editors like emacs or vi.
> 
> This is my /etc/.profile file configured for the Spanish keyboard (ie.
> dieresis, accents, n~,...).  All you should do is changing:
> export LC_ALL=es_ES
> for:
> export LC_ALL=es_DE
> 

Shouldn't it be de_DE?

Check out /usr/share/locale/*.  It looks like country code (probably
ISO 3166) first, then language code (ISO 639).
